Why Choose Tub Safe Accessibility Products?
Traditional bathtubs and showers, while familiar, often become obstacles with age or changing physical abilities. Steps can be difficult to navigate, and the risk of slipping or falling poses serious concerns. Tub Safe addresses these issues head-on by specializing in modifications and replacements that prioritize ease of use.
Enhanced Safety Features
Safety is paramount in any bathroom setting. Our products incorporate features designed to minimize risks. Consider walk-in tubs equipped with built-in seat liners and safety bars, allowing for effortless entry and exit without the need for external grab bars that can be slippery or cumbersome. Alternatively, our specialized shower chairs and transfer benches provide stable support, enabling safe mobility within the shower area.
Improved Accessibility
Accessibility modifications are about more than just convenience; they're about maintaining independence. By installing features like handheld showerheads on flexible arms, adjustable height seats, or even walk-in showers with zero-threshold doors, we empower individuals to perform daily hygiene tasks with greater ease and confidence. These changes can significantly improve quality of life for seniors, people with disabilities, recovering patients, and anyone seeking greater bathroom independence.

2. Are the walk-in tubs installed by Tub Safe easy to use for someone with limited mobility?
Absolutely. Walk-in tubs from Tub Safe feature a low or zero-step entry, often with a built-in seat liner. Users can sit down gently and comfortably before filling the tub, and the seat provides a stable base. Once finished, the seat retracts, and the tub drains automatically. This design makes entering and exiting the tub much simpler and safer for individuals with limited mobility compared to traditional bathtubs.
